Safety Study of PPI-1019 in Subjects With Mild-Moderate Alzheimer's Disease

Alzheimer's Disease

This is a single-center, double-blind, inpatient study followed by an outpatient, placebo-controlled, multiple-IV injection evaluation of the safety and tolerability of PPI-1019 in subjects with mild-moderate Alzheimer's disease (AD). The primary objective of the study is to assess the safety of multiple IV injections of PPI-1019 in subjects with mild-moderate Alzheimer's disease.

Testing the Effectiveness of Telephone Support for Dementia Caregivers

DementiaAlzheimer Disease

The primary goal of the study is documentation of effectiveness of telephone support groups to reduce caregiver burden and stress. Caregivers who participate in intervention (Telephone Support) should experience lower levels of stress, burden and health care utilization (lower use of psychotropic drugs, fewer scheduled/unscheduled medical visits, lower rates of institutionalization, more efficient use of time in managing care recipient problems) compared to those caregivers in Usual Care.
